Abstract
These lectures will review symmetry-breaking phase transitions and the formation of topological defects, primarily in the context of cosmology but also with reference to condensed matter. The idea that early in its history the Universe went through a series of phase transitions will be discussed. Following a discussion of the basic ideas of spontaneous symmetry breaking, the classification of defects in terms of homotopy groups of the vacuum manifold will be reviewed, covering domain walls, cosmic strings or vortices, monopoles and textures and also composite objects of various kinds. The importance of the central problem of estimating the density of defects formed at a phase transition will be emphasized, with reference both to cosmology and to recent low-temperature experiments.
